4. Sync, partner sharing & backup

With Plumi Pro you can sync your data across your own devices and share a baby's record with a partner or caregiver. This sync is end-to-end encrypted: your data is encrypted on your device with a key that stays on your devices, and our servers only ever hold ciphertext we cannot read. The encryption key is never sent to us. Sharing is per child: you choose which children each person can see and whether they can edit or only view. A child you don't share with someone is never delivered to them in any form; they never receive that child's encryption key or data.

You can also keep a local iCloud Drive backup through your own private iCloud account, governed by Apple's Privacy Policy. Sync, sharing and backup are all optional and off until you turn them on. Other than these, nothing leaves your device.
